On Form Factors of SU(2) Invariant Thirring Model
Atsushi Nakayashiki, Yoshihiro Takeyama

Abstract
Integral formulae for form factors of a large family of charged local operators in SU(2) invariant Thirring model are given extending Smirnov's construction of form factors of chargeless local operators in the sine-Gordon model. New abelian symmetry acting on this family of local operators is found. It creates Lukyanov's operators which are not in the above family of local operators in general.
